Larry Stonitsch

Class of 1990

Joliet Central

Larry began his wrestling career at Joliet twp. High School under the coaching of Perry Goransen. He was a 2 time State Qualifier. After graduation, he entered the United States Marine Corps where he boxed and Wrestled. After his service ended he began working in the Joliet area.

1967 found the Joliet Boys club’s Wrestling program, which had just begun, lacking a coach due to a death. Larry responded to the call and joined up with this club immediately and continued to be extremely active until 1978, when he began to follow his own son’s progress, however always remaining in the background and supporting the Club, assisting at the YMCA and Tournament.

During his active coaching years he had State Champions at the Junior High School level. The State Championship series was not started until 1970, a number of these boys later became High School champions or place winners. The number of State place winners Larry coached was numerous. During this time Larry was Also President of the Boys Club. Team Wise, they were State Champions once; second two times; third once and for Nine Years were never below 5th.

220 wins-5 losses-1 tie

* Member of original group of coaches that formed the Illinois Kids Federation in 1970

* President of that group in 1977-78

* Illinois State Delegate to National Kids Convention for 3 years

* 1972 he coached US Team in the first Pan AM youth championships held in Mexico City, US won the tournament, 7 champions, 2 2nd’s and 3rd of all 10 weight classes
